Transaction 381252538a888fecc101d10f222cd382ada2494dcb4b6551cc5536c15e71bc4b
1 Input
1 Output
-
381252538a888fecc101d10f222cd382ada2494dcb4b6551cc5536c15e71bc4b:0
- value
- 22306
- script pubkey
- OP_0 OP_PUSHBYTES_20 38c5d43b228f88ab72ba0fd23b7968e5478aba09
- address
- bc1q8rzagwez37y2ku46plfrk7tgu4rc4wsfge9lkn